PROBLEM TO BE SOLVED: To enable valuable metals contained in waste lithium batteries to be selectively separated, purified, and recovered by extracting the metals with a phosphorus compd. such as a bis(1,1,3,3-tetramethylbutyl)phosphinic acid deriv. ;SOLUTION: This extractant for valuable metals comprises a phosphorus compd. represented by the formula (wherein X1 and X2 are each O or S) [e.g. bis(1,1,3,3-tetramethylbutyl)phosphinic acid deriv.]. Valuable metals such as Co and Ni are recovered as follows: a crushing product obtd. by baking and crushing waste lithium batteries is treated with an aq. alkali soln. (e.g. an aq. ammonia soln.); thus obtd. recovered product is dissolved in an aq. mineral acid (e.g. sulfuric acid) soln. and filtered to be separated into a soln. and a residue; then the soln. under the control of pH is brought into contact with a soln. of the extractant in a solvent (e.g. toluene) to conduct extraction and separation; and the extractant soln. is brought into contact with an aq. mineral acid soln. to cause backward extraction and separation to recover high-purity valuable metals.;COPYRIGHT: (C)1998,JPO
